Witnessing verbal sparring and heated arguments can be stressful for children, especially in a divorce situation. When parents decide to end their marriage, they naturally worry how their divorce will affect their children. They might even have bad memories of their own parents’ divorce, which can make them reluctant to move forward with the divorce process. However, research shows that children thrive more in a divorce situation than they do in unhappy households filled with bickering parents and high levels of conflict. If you and your spouse are unable to work it out, it may be better for your children if you and your spouse go your separate ways rather than try to stay aboard a sinking ship. It’s very important for both parents to be careful about doing anything that makes the child feel like he or she is taking sides For parents going through a divorce, the prospect of having their children testify in court is often frightening or stressful. Understandably, they worry about their kids — especially very young children — experiencing trauma or fear in an intimidating courtroom setting. Although children aren’t required to testify in custody or divorce proceedings, it’s sometimes helpful for the case if they do. If you’re worried about how your child will handle testifying in court, it’s important to discuss your concerns with your North Carolina divorce lawyer. Your attorney can help you explore your options and make arrangements for the experience to be less stressful for you and your child.
